🔍 What is the Australian Pension?
The Australian pension is a financial benefit that the Australian government grants to citizens and permanent residents who meet certain age, income and asset criteria. This support is vital to ensure a dignified retirement.
📌 Basic Aspects About the Pension Fund
- The minimum pension in Australia varies according to your marital status and assets.
- The pension system in Australia is based on age, residence and financial means.
- There are two main types: Age Pension (retirement) and Disability Support Pension (disability).
📝 What Are the Requirements to Get Pension in Australia?
To access the Age Pension, you must meet:
✔ Age: Currently 67 years (increasing progressively).
✔ Residence: At least 10 years in Australia (with 5 continuous years).
✔ Income and assets test: Your assets affect the amount received.
⚠ Can I have two houses and still receive pension in Australia?
Yes, but the value of your second property may affect the calculation of your benefits.

❓ 10 Frequently Asked Questions About Australian Pension
- What is the minimum pension in Australia?
- For singles: ~$1,002 AUD fortnightly.
- For couples: ~$755 AUD each fortnightly.
- Can I work and receive pension?
Yes, but your income will affect the amount. - Is pension compatible with other benefits?
It depends on the type of benefit. - What happens if I move outside Australia?
You can continue receiving pension, but with certain conditions. - How is the pension amount calculated?
It’s based on income, assets and family situation. - Can I inherit a pension?
No, pension is not transferable. - Are there pensions for widows/widowers?
Yes, there is the Widow Allowance in some cases. - What documents do I need to apply for pension?
Identification, proof of residence and financial statements. - How long does the application take to be approved?
Generally between 4 and 6 weeks. - Can I appeal if my pension is rejected?
Yes, you can request a review.

🔍 Why Plan Your Retirement in Australia?
Australia is not only a natural paradise but also one of the best countries to retire, thanks to its solid pension and superannuation system. However, to enjoy it to the fullest, you need a smart strategy.
📌 3 Key Pillars for Your Retirement in Australia
- Age Pension: The state pension for those over 67.
- Superannuation: Your private retirement fund.
- Complementary investments: Properties, stocks or businesses.
📝 Key Tips to Plan Your Retirement in Australia
1. Know the Requirements for Age Pension
✔ Minimum age: 67 years (and rising).
✔ Residence: At least 10 years in Australia (5 continuous).
✔ Income and asset limits: Vary according to your situation.
2. Maximize Your Superannuation
✅ Contribute voluntarily to increase your savings.
✅ Invest in low-risk options as you approach retirement.
✅ Consult with a financial advisor specialized in retirement in Australia.
3. Strategically Reduce Your Assets
⚠ Did you know that having two properties can affect your pension? If you plan to keep a second home, consider how it will impact your benefits.
4. Prepare for Taxes
✍️ Income from superannuation and pension have different tax treatments.
❓ 10 Frequently Asked Questions About Retirement in Australia
- What is the best age to retire in Australia?
Depends on your savings, but the Age Pension starts at 67. - Can I access my superannuation before retiring?
Only in special cases (eg: disability or financial hardship). - How much money do I need to retire comfortably?
According to experts, about $500,000 AUD in superannuation is a good starting point. - What happens if I move abroad after retiring?
You can continue receiving the Age Pension, but with restrictions. - How does inheritance affect my retirement?
Receiving an inheritance may impact your benefits if you exceed asset limits. - Are there additional benefits for retirees?
Yes, such as discounts on transport, health and utilities. - Can I keep working after retiring?
Of course! But your income will affect your pension amount. - What is “Transition to Retirement” (TTR)?
A strategy that allows you to partially access your superannuation while reducing working hours. - How do I protect my savings from inflation?
Invest in index funds or properties with good appreciation. - Where can I get legal advice about my retirement?
A lawyer specialized in pensions in Australia can help you with legal matters.
